And so it begins...with only 6 weeks until this baby joins us we know that our time to transfer Max from the crib into a big boy bed has come. So on Saturday we rearranged the boys room to make space for Max. Travis tried to convince me that we should just buy a toddler bed and a bunch of tubs for his clothes, but I really wanted Max to have a place in our home...not just a make shift spot. So after purchasing a mattress, bunkboard, and rails he now has a place. I also scored an awesome dresser at Ikea for $75...I will post pictures...we haven't put it together yet!
So last night was his first official night. Oh BOY!! Can I just say how much the anticipation of new changes stresses me out! We started the "into bed" process around 7pm. He cried for a bit but got really quite about 20 minutes later. I thought "there is NO WAY it is going to be this easy!" and...it wasn't. He didn't cry mind you, but he was laying on the floor or in his bed until almost 9:15pm. I guess I should be grateful that it wasn't hours of crying, but it took him FOREVER to fall asleep. Once he was asleep we were able to put the boys to bed. Then around 4am he woke up disoriented and unsure of where he was. Travis got up and layed next to him for a while and thought he was asleep, but he wasn't and started to cry. This woke up Noah and Zach. So we decided to plop him into the crib for the rest of the night so that the boys could go back to sleep.
Wish us luck tonight with round #2...

father's day project...
So this year I decided to make a gift for Travis. This required a little planning, but I am pleased with the way that it turned out. The only glitch was that on the day I was taking pictures Noah didn't feel well. I had to convince him to get up off the couch and get dressed. He totally looks like I was forcing him to smile...which I guess I was...I plan on retaking his picture and swapping a new one in. I picked up the unfinished letters at Hobby Lobby and modge podged some scrapbook paper on and then inked the edges. The best part is that I really only had to buy 3 letters a "D, A, and Y"...
I think it will be a cute and easy thing to redo each year.
